The men's and women's swim teams at Fredonia State were recognized by the College Swimming and Diving Coaches Association of America (CSCAA) as Academic All America.
The Fredonia State men's swimming and diving team competed in day one of the SUNYAC meet on Feb. 21. The highlight of the night for Fredonia State came when Patrick McCrone set a new school record in the 50-yard backstroke.

The Fredonia State men's swim team took on Hobart College at home on Saturday. Aaron Burkett took home three firsts, and Noah Wisniewski had two firsts and a second-place finish. Alex Wright also won an event.
Noah Wisniewski had first-place finishes in a pair of races in the 11-event season opening meet at Pitt-Bradford on Saturday.
The Fredonia State Athletic Department held its annual senior recognition and awards banquet, The FREDDIES, on May 9. Patrick McCrone and Erin Woods were recognized as the Male and Female Athletes of the Year.
Patrick McCrone used his last meet before the conference championships to put up some impressive times. McCrone would win the 100- and 200-backstrokes, and the 200 IM.
The Fredonia State men's swim team competed in a tri-meet on Saturday. Patrick McCrone won the 100 backstroke in 1:55.0 and was second in the 1000 free in a time of 10:39.68.
The Fredonia State men's swim team's Patrick McCrone won two events at the three-team tri-meet at SUNY Buffalo State on Saturday. The Orchard Park native took the 200 backstroke and 500 freestyle.
Patrick McCrone and Mike Viollis were triple winners as the Fredonia State men's swim team defeated Hobart 137-26 on Saturday. Lucas Weiner and Tyler Conti both won two events, and Noah Wisniewski combined with Conti, Violis and McCrone to win the 200 free relay.
